One more thing for the OP, if you do go to a new presta wheelset, you might want to also look into how to convert your quick release disc hubs to a thru-axle setup for safety reasons.

I’m not familiar with what is available for your existing fork. It may be necessary to swap out the existing quick release fork on the escape for one that will accept a thru-axle.

To keep costs down, I would only be concerned with the front hub setup since that is where most of the stopping power is applied.

Down the road you can look into adapting the rear, or swapping out the frame. If you swap out the frame, I’d look for one where you can transfer your components over.
